Transaction 8a677876835121ed2f31bb501dee1a2ad3da8409fca3332517374a697034155b
1 Input
1 Output
-
8a677876835121ed2f31bb501dee1a2ad3da8409fca3332517374a697034155b:0
- value
- 66450
- script pubkey
- OP_0 OP_PUSHBYTES_32 58835841b02479c007e3534e18221812609de8b9fac5b4f0af2beb2ba98992d6
- address
- bc1qtzp4ssdsy3uuqplr2d8psgsczfsfm69eltzmfu90904jh2vfjttqqp687u